Each time you eat and drink, your body absorbs liquids. The kidneys filter out waste and make urine. The urine is stored in your bladder. Your bladder tells the brain when it's full. That's when you get the feeling that you need to go to the bathroom.
The normal bladder muscle expands like a balloon to hold a cup or 2 of urine. As it fills, you feel stronger and stronger urges to go. When you are ready, you walk to the bathroom. Then you give your bladder the OK to go.

The overactive bladder muscle doesn't wait until it's full to send an urgent signal. It can send emergency "false alarms" again and again. That can cause strong sudden urges to urinate. And may even lead to an accident.

Detrol® LA (tolterodine tartrate extended release capsules) treats the symptoms of overactive bladder (leaks, strong sudden urges to go, going too often).
If you have certain stomach problems, glaucoma, or cannot empty your bladder, you should not take Detrol LA.
Detrol LA may cause allergic reactions that may be serious. Symptoms of a serious allergic reaction may include swelling of the face, lips, throat, or tongue. If you experience these symptoms, you should stop taking Detrol LA and get emergency medical help right away.
Medicines like Detrol LA can cause blurred vision, dizziness, or drowsiness. Use caution while driving or doing other dangerous activities until you know how Detrol LA affects you.
The most common side effects with Detrol LA are dry mouth, constipation, headache, and stomach pain.
